Facility insight: MERCK SHARP & DOHME LLC - RAHWAY

MERCK SHARP & DOHME LLC - RAHWAY (GHGRP ID 1003261) is a high-volume reporter at 88K MT CO₂e in 2023 from RAHWAY, NJ (#2,865 of 8,713 nationally) under Chemicals (NAICS 325412).

Across 2011–2023, annual CO₂e fell 12.5%; peak load was 102K MT in 2018. This facility has filed every year from 2011 to 2023, a complete 13-year record.

Peak year was 2018 at 102K MT CO2e; latest 2023 sits 13.2% below that peak (88K MT). The largest year-to-year move was 2017→2018 (+45.8%, 32K MT).
